Start with the Basics
The foundation of any hotel-style bedroom is the bedding. Invest in high-quality sheets, duvet covers, and pillows to create a luxurious and comfortable sleeping experience. Look for materials like Egyptian cotton or bamboo for a soft and smooth feel. You can also add a touch of luxury with a plush throw blanket or a few decorative pillows.
Keep it Simple
When it comes to hotel-style bedrooms, less is more. Stick to a neutral color palette with pops of color for a modern and sophisticated look. Avoid clutter and unnecessary decorations, as they can make the room feel cramped and chaotic. Instead, opt for a few statement pieces, such as a bold headboard or a unique piece of artwork.
Add Some Greenery
Plants are a great way to add a touch of nature and freshness to your bedroom. Choose low-maintenance plants like succulents or a small potted tree to add a pop of green without requiring too much upkeep. You can also incorporate fresh flowers into your decor for a touch of elegance and color.
Upgrade Your Lighting
Lighting can make or break the ambiance of a room. Invest in a few modern and stylish light fixtures to add a touch of sophistication to your bedroom. You can also incorporate different types of lighting, such as bedside lamps and overhead lighting, to create a warm and inviting atmosphere.
Incorporate Texture
To add depth and interest to your bedroom, incorporate different textures into your decor. This can be achieved through a variety of ways, such as adding a faux fur rug, a velvet throw pillow, or a woven basket for storage. These small touches can make a big impact and give your bedroom a luxurious feel.
Shop Secondhand
Don't be afraid to shop secondhand for furniture and decor
items. You can often find high-quality pieces at a fraction of the cost. Look
for vintage or antique pieces that can add character and charm to your bedroom.
You can also repurpose items, such as using a vintage trunk as a bedside table
or a ladder as a decorative piece.
